Recognizing the Signs of Gambling Addiction

Gambling addiction, often referred to as compulsive gambling, manifests through a range of emotional and behavioral indicators. One prominent sign is the inability to stop gambling despite negative consequences. Individuals may find themselves chasing losses, believing that the next bet will yield a win that compensates for previous losses. This can lead to mounting debts and strained relationships, as friends and family may not understand the compulsive nature of the addiction. Another common sign of gambling addiction is preoccupation with gambling. Individuals might spend excessive amounts of time thinking about past gambling experiences or planning future bets. This constant mental engagement can disrupt daily life, affecting work performance and personal relationships. Those struggling may often lie about their gambling habits, further isolating themselves from loved ones and deepening the cycle of addiction.

Physical symptoms may also be present in individuals with a gambling addiction. Increased anxiety, irritability, and mood swings can surface when trying to cut back on gambling or during times of financial strain. These emotional upheavals can lead to a decline in overall well-being, making it vital for individuals to recognize these signs early and seek help before the situation escalates.

The Impact of Gambling Addiction on Life

The repercussions of gambling addiction extend far beyond financial distress. Relationships with family and friends often suffer as the individual becomes consumed by their addiction. Trust issues can arise when a person lies about their gambling activities, leading to a breakdown in communication. Families may experience emotional strain as loved ones grapple with the addiction, resulting in feelings of helplessness and frustration.

Financially, the toll of gambling addiction can be devastating. Many individuals risk their savings, fall into debt, or even face bankruptcy due to their gambling behaviors. The pursuit of quick wins can overshadow rational thinking, leading to poor financial decisions that have long-lasting consequences. This financial strain can amplify feelings of guilt and shame, exacerbating the addiction cycle.

Additionally, gambling addiction can have severe mental health effects. Many individuals suffer from anxiety, depression, and feelings of hopelessness as they grapple with their addiction. This mental toll can lead to unhealthy coping mechanisms, such as substance abuse, further complicating recovery efforts. Recognizing the extensive impact of gambling addiction is essential for both individuals and their loved ones as they navigate the path to recovery.

How to Seek Help for Gambling Addiction

Seeking help for gambling addiction is a crucial step toward recovery. One of the most effective routes is to consult with a mental health professional specializing in addiction. These professionals can provide tailored therapy options, such as cognitive-behavioral therapy, which helps individuals recognize harmful thought patterns and develop healthier coping mechanisms. Joining support groups can also be beneficial, as they offer a sense of community and shared experiences.

Another viable option is to engage in self-exclusion programs available at many gambling establishments. These programs allow individuals to voluntarily ban themselves from gambling venues for a specified duration, creating a necessary buffer to break free from the cycle of addiction. Combining this with a strong support network can significantly enhance the chances of recovery.

Finally, educating oneself about gambling addiction and its effects can empower individuals to take control of their lives. Understanding the psychological and emotional triggers behind compulsive gambling can foster better decision-making. This knowledge can motivate individuals to seek help proactively rather than waiting for the consequences to escalate. Support from friends and family is also crucial during this journey, providing the encouragement needed to overcome challenges.

Resources Available for Recovery

Numerous resources are available to assist individuals struggling with gambling addiction. National helplines provide immediate support and guidance, helping individuals identify local treatment options. These helplines are confidential and can connect individuals with counselors who specialize in gambling addiction, offering tailored strategies for recovery.

Additionally, many communities have local support groups, such as Gamblers Anonymous, which create a safe space for individuals to share their experiences and learn from one another. These groups operate on a peer-support model, emphasizing shared recovery journeys and accountability. Such environments can be invaluable, as they foster understanding and empathy among participants.

Online resources and forums can also provide anonymity and support for those hesitant to seek in-person help. These platforms often contain valuable information on coping strategies, recovery success stories, and professional resources. Engaging with others who understand the struggle can provide the encouragement needed to stay committed to the recovery process.
